Hi, My ward is now taking role electronically, through the LDS Tools app but having challenges marking adults or orgnization leaders who may attend multiple classes. For example, if the Young Women's leadership attends the 12-13 year old class one week and the 14-15 year old class next week, the Secretary has to log into multiple classes to mark the leader. Similarly for Relief Society and Elder's Quorum it can be tricky to keep accurate roles for Primary teachers. Is it possible to list people in multiple classes (Primary & Relief Society)? Thanks!

How would the secretary log into multiple classes to mark leader attendance? The young women presidency and all young women adult leaders and teachers do not show up in the Member Tools, or LCR , Young Women Class roles for attendance. They only appear in the Relief Society roles for attendance. The Young Women secretary does not have access to the Relief Society class role to mark attendance.

The Sunday School secretary has access to all Sunday School class attendance roles youth courses and the adult Gospel Doctrine. But the adult leaders and teachers are not found listed in the youth classes for attendance. So when the Sunday School secretary is taking Sunday School attendance he would have to select the Gospel Doctrine class to mark the attendance of the adult leaders and teachers attending a youth course.

It is not possible for the Primary secretary to access the Relief Society and Elders Quorum meeting attendance roster to record Primary leader and teacher attendance in Primary classes. The Primary secretary has to coordinate with the RS and EQ secretaries the Primary leader and teacher attendance.

With that understanding of how the Class and Quorum Attendance tool currently works you can see that taking everyone's attendance electronically real time is not possible today.
